The growing season is underway at the Dakota County Juvenile Services Center! Juvenile Services program participants recently joined with University of Minnesota Extension master gardeners and Dakota County leaders to plant a garden that will provide fruits and vegetables for Dakota County food shelves. Board Chair, Joe Atkins, Dakota County Commissioner Bill Droste, along with Community Corrections Director Suwana Kirkland, Deputy Director Matt Bauer, and Director of Community Services Marti Fischbach helped with planting the garden, located outside the Juvenile Services Center in Hastings. This is the third year of the program, which generated over 500 pounds of food last year. Most of the food was donated to food shelves, though some was consumed by youth in the New Chance Program and at the Juvenile Services Center.
